Browse Source

feat: 修改

year 10 hours ago
parent
commit
1a768dd36b

BIN
public_original/icon-192x192.png


BIN
public_original/icon-512x512.png


+ 3 - 1
src/api/activity.ts

@@ -170,7 +170,8 @@ export interface PromoterInfo {
     tally_time: number;
     is_op: boolean;
     remark: string;
-
+    agent_text: string;
+    agent_images: { image: string; text: string }[];
     list: { count: number; conf: PromoterItem[]; condition: PromoterCondition; total: number };
 }
 
@@ -343,6 +344,7 @@ export interface CommissionItem {
     user_name: string;
     pay_amount: number;
     commission_amount: number;
+    phone?: string;
 }
 
 export interface AgentPayInfo {

+ 6 - 2
src/app/[locale]/(doings)/fission/(locale)/page.tsx

@@ -315,10 +315,14 @@ const Page: React.FC = () => {
                             Copiar
                         </CustomButton>
                     </div> */}
-                    <ShareText></ShareText>
+                    <ShareText text={data?.agent_text}></ShareText>
 
                     <div className="pt-[.1rem]">
-                        <AdSwiperBox></AdSwiperBox>
+                        <AdSwiperBox
+                            className="mt-[.1rem]"
+                            text={data?.agent_text}
+                            images={data?.agent_images}
+                        ></AdSwiperBox>
                     </div>
                     <div className="felx my-[15px] w-full flex-col rounded-[var(--borderRadius)] bg-[var(--primary13)] p-[15px]">
                         <div className="flex flex-col gap-[10px] break-all text-[12px] text-[var(--textColor2)]">

+ 6 - 4
src/app/[locale]/(doings)/rechargeRefund/page.tsx

@@ -5,7 +5,7 @@ import CustomButton from "@/components/CustomButton";
 import InviteBox from "@/components/InviteBox";
 import ShareText from "@/components/ShareText";
 import { useRouter } from "@/i18n/routing";
-import { formatAmount } from "@/utils";
+import { cryptoStr, formatAmount } from "@/utils";
 import { Toast } from "antd-mobile";
 import clsx from "clsx";
 import { useTranslations } from "next-intl";
@@ -157,12 +157,14 @@ const Page = () => {
                     data.commissions.map((item) => {
                         return (
                             <div key={item.user_id} className="flex items-center justify-between">
-                                <div className="flex-1 py-[.08rem] text-center">{item.user_id}</div>
                                 <div className="flex-1 py-[.08rem] text-center">
-                                    {item.pay_amount}
+                                    {cryptoStr(item.phone || "")}
                                 </div>
                                 <div className="flex-1 py-[.08rem] text-center">
-                                    {item.commission_amount}
+                                    R$ {item.pay_amount}
+                                </div>
+                                <div className="flex-1 py-[.08rem] text-center">
+                                    R$ {item.commission_amount}
                                 </div>
                             </div>
                         );